All Physicians and Healthcare Leaders will be involved in project management in one way or another - this course will prepare you for project management using the knowledge, vocabulary, and tools that professional project managers use. From Scope management to creating a quality management plan, this course will help you plan any project - big or small!


In this course I will review the following areas:

  1. Introduction - what is a project, an overview of project management, role of the manager and who are stakeholders

  2. Initiating Your Project - We will cover writing a business case and charter

  3. Planning Your Project- an overview of how to determine scope, breakdown work and schedule, manage resources, quality, communication and mitigate risk

  4. Executing Your Project - this section is all about teams and team dynamics as you execute your project

  5. Monitor & Control Your Project

  6. Close Your Project

The course is eligible for 1 AMA CME Credit for physicians - please complete the reflection task at CMEfy, link in resources at the end of the course.


By the end of this course you will have a clear understanding of what are the steps of how to manage a project from idea to closing it out, as well as know some of the key tools that professional project managers use along the way.
